reflection on Ch. 43 to 81 of Tao

Tao De Jing is the first complete philosophy book in Chinese History, or even in the World History. In this book, it proposes people should live in a balance of everything. For example, we shouldn’t be angry or happy; we should be feeling normal everyday. Also, it shows a way of how to rule a country for leaders. In ruling countries, it proposes that if the leader can make his people have nothing to do, he would be the best leader. In philosophy side, it says everything has two extreme sides, and whenever we reach one of the extremes, it will go to the opposite way.
This book changed Chinese people’s mind for 2,000 years. The things were taught from the book was used by the emperors in every dynasty.
